Pull type high-protection emergency stop button with lamp
By designing a pull-type high-protection illuminated emergency stop button, which uses a snap-fit structure and a waterproof ring, the problem of insufficient protection of existing illuminated emergency stop buttons is solved, and reliable power cut-off and intuitive indication are achieved in high-protection environments.

AI Technical Summary
Existing emergency stop buttons with lights lack robust protection in emergency situations, are susceptible to moisture intrusion, are not easy to operate, and have insufficiently intuitive indication.
A pull-type high-protection emergency stop button with an indicator light was designed. It adopts an emergency stop cap and push rod buckle structure, combined with a waterproof ring and mechanical latch, to ensure reliable power cut-off in emergency situations. The semi-transparent emergency stop cap and the curved push rod reflect light to improve the indication effect.
It achieves reliable power cut-off under IP67 protection level, prevents moisture intrusion, operates smoothly with clear indicators, has a simple structure, low wear, is easy to assemble, and is suitable for high protection environments.

TECHNICAL FIELD
[0001] The utility model belongs to the field of control electric appliances, more particularly relates to a kind of high protection with lamp emergency stop button of pat. BACKGROUND
[0002] Emergency stop button is a kind of main control electric appliance, when equipment is in dangerous state, power is cut off or signal is given to cut off power through emergency stop button, so that equipment stops working, to avoid accidents;With lamp emergency stop button is equipped with indicator lamp in addition to the function of ordinary emergency stop button.Indicator lamp can provide visual warning in emergency, remind operator that equipment is in emergency stop state. DETAILED DESCRIPTION
[0021] The embodiments of the utility model are further described below in combination with the drawings.
[0022] AsFigs. 1 to 3 As shown in the figure, a pull type high protection belt lamp emergency stop button includes a knob head and a light emitting module assembly 8, the knob head is assembled on the light emitting module assembly 8, the knob head includes:
[0023] The emergency stop cap 1 includes an inner cap wall 101 and an outer cap wall 102, the inner cap wall 101 is provided with a groove 103; the emergency stop cap 1 is made of a translucent material and can transmit light.
[0024] The emergency stop shell 3 includes an upper shell end 31 and a lower shell end 32, the upper shell end 31 includes an inner wall and an outer wall, the outer wall is provided with a waterproof ring mounting groove 33, the waterproof ring mounting groove 33 is mounted with a waterproof ring 2, the waterproof ring 2 has a V-shaped cross section and is mounted with the V-shaped opening downward in the waterproof ring mounting groove 33; the lower shell end 32 is internally provided with an arc-shaped protrusion 34 and externally provided with an external thread 35, the external thread 35 is mounted with a thread ring 7; the external thread 35 and the thread ring 7 are further provided with a waterproof pad 6.
[0025] The push rod 5 includes an upper push rod 51 and a lower push rod 52, the upper push rod 51 and the lower push rod 52 are provided with a boss 53, the end of the upper push rod 51 and the end of the lower push rod 52 are provided with reverse buckles, the lower push rod 52 is provided with a lock latch mounting hole, a mechanical lock latch 9 and a lock latch spring 10 are assembled in the lock latch mounting hole; the push rod 5 is assembled in the emergency stop shell 3, the reverse buckle of the end of the upper push rod 51 is buckled and mounted with the groove 103 of the inner cap wall 101 of the emergency stop cap, the groove 103 has a downward movement stroke of 2-5 mm; the reverse buckle of the lower push rod 52 is buckled and mounted with the arc-shaped protrusion 34 of the inner wall of the lower shell end 32 of the emergency stop shell 3; the center of the push rod 5 is hollow and has an arc-shaped surface, the light emitting element of the light emitting module assembly 8 is located in the hollow center of the push rod 5.
[0026] The center spring 4 is assembled on the upper push rod 51, the upper end of the center spring 4 abuts against the inner cap wall 101 of the emergency stop cap 1, and the lower end of the center spring 4 is limited by the boss 53.
[0027] As one of the improvement schemes, the lock latch mounting hole and the corresponding mechanical lock latch 9 and lock latch spring 10 in the lower push rod 52 are provided with multiple pairs and are uniformly distributed on the lower push rod 52.
[0028] The assembly process is briefly described as follows:
[0029] First, the mechanical lock latch 9 and the lock latch spring 10 are assembled in the hole of the push rod 5, and are assembled in the emergency stop shell 3 together with the push rod 5, the center spring 4 is sleeved on the push rod 5, then the pull type high protection belt lamp emergency stop button knob head is assembled by buckling the reverse buckle mechanism of the push rod 5, finally, the waterproof pad 6 and the thread ring 7 are assembled, thus the assembly of the entire pull type high protection belt lamp emergency stop button knob head is completed, then the knob head is assembled on the light emitting module assembly 8, the light emitting module assembly 8 is assembled and connected with the buckle mechanism on the emergency stop shell 3 through the rotation buckle mechanism, thus the assembly of the entire pull type high protection belt lamp emergency stop button switch is completed.
[0030] Working principle:
[0031] By pressing the pull and stop cap 1, the push rod 5 is driven to move downward, the center spring 4 is compressed, and under the action of the elastic force, the push rod 5 carries the mechanical latch 9 to move downward, so that the mechanical latch 9 is extruded into the hole of the push rod 5 by the boss on the stop shell 3, and after the mechanical latch 9 passes the boss structure inside the stop shell 3, the mechanical latch 9 is extruded by the boss on the stop shell 3, so that the overall mechanism cannot be reset; manually pulling the pull and stop cap 1, the mechanical latch 9 slides through the boss of the stop shell 3, and is reset under the action of the pulling force.
[0032] In the structure of the utility model, the mechanical latch 9 is a machined stainless steel part, the surface is smooth, and the front end face is a circular arc structure, so that the sliding is more smooth when being stressed, and the stainless steel material is durable;
[0033] The center of the push rod 5 is an arc surface structure, so that the lamp beads in the light emitting module assembly 8 pass through the hole, the light emitted by the lamp beads in the light emitting module assembly 8 is diffusely reflected and then passes through the semi-transparent pull and stop cap, so that the light is emitted, and the more intuitive warning effect is achieved;
[0034] In the initial state diagram, the pull and stop cap 1 is pressed downward by about 2mm, the push rod 5 does not move downward, so the contact module does not act, thereby the safety protection and the anti-miscontact function are achieved;
[0035] The waterproof ring 2 has a unique "V" type structure, the V-shaped opening is installed downward in the waterproof ring installation groove, can effectively block water from entering the switch, when water flows from the pull and stop cap 1 and the stop shell 3, the assembled waterproof ring 2 is opened, so that water enters the switch inside is hindered, and the high protection effect is achieved.
